I was wondering about Dhammacakkappavattana Sutta. All i know is that when buddha turned the dhamma wheel for the first time, all of the residents of Devalokas and The Rupa-Brahmalokas came and claps their hands. There's this 1 phrase which sounds: "Brahmakayika deva saddamanussavesum" As for Brahmakayika is the lowest of brahmaloka [1st Jhana Realm]. I don't think brahmakayika could represent all of the rupa-brahmalokas [Inculiding 1st 2nd 3rd and 4th Jhana Realms] The Question is, why other rupa-brahmalokas name were not included or unwritten in the text, did they forget to write it or is there any missing text during that time?
